Responsibilities:
Lead the development and management of clinical contracts, ensuring compliance with organizational policies and industry regulations.
Coordinate cross-functional collaboration for contract reviews, facilitating communication between legal, finance, operations, quality and business stakeholders.
Implement and maintain a strategic prioritization system for contract reviews to ensure timely processing of agreements.
Monitor contract timelines, track expiration dates, and proactively initiate renewal processes to maintain business continuity.
Establish new accounts, including implementing pricing in relevant systems, defining cadence of billing, and tracking payment details.
Manage billing operations, resolve pricing discrepancies, address inquiries, and collaborate with Finance on account resolution.
Oversee order management, ensuring accuracy and compliance with contractual terms.
This role will require to work in US time zone (4pm – 12.30am IST).
Basic qualifications
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, or related field.
6-8 years of experience in Contracts management
Proven experience troubleshooting issues in Contracts, setting up new accounts
Strong vendor management skills with the ability to negotiate contracts and build productive business relationships.
Experience in managing Billing operations.
Demonstrated ability to lead continuous improvement initiatives that enhance operational efficiency.
Strong analytical skills with proficiency in data analysis and reporting tools.
